Web4 aug. 2024 · However, some symptoms are common to most gastrointestinal problems. Common symptoms include: Abdominal discomfort (bloating, pain or cramps) Unintentional weight loss. Vomiting and nausea. Acid reflux (heartburn) Diarrhea, constipation (or sometimes both) Fecal incontinence. Fatigue.

WebGastrointestinal (GI) exams are X-ray exams that examine your GI tract, including your esophagus, stomach, small intestine, large intestine and rectum. A type of X-ray called fluoroscopy allows health care providers to take video images of the organs in action. There are different variations, depending on which organs are being examined.
